Birmingham-bound train arrives at Coventry railway station

Image: © Andy F Taken: 25 Nov 2009

Looking in the up (east) direction from platform 1, Coventry station. A Class 390 'Pendolino' electric train (number 390027) operated by Virgin Trains is pulling in to platform 3 on an 'EBW' (Euston-Birmingham-Wolverhampton) service.
